def RunSteps(api):
cipd_pkg_dir = api.path['start_dir'].join('fonts')
api.file.ensure_directory('makedirs', cipd_pkg_dir)
git_repositories = []
for repository in REPOSITORIES:
repository_name = repository.url.rsplit('/', 1)[-1]
with api.step.nest(repository_name):
src_dir = api.path['start_dir'].join('src', repository_name)
git_sha = api.git.checkout(repository.url, src_dir, ref=repository.ref)
git_repositories.append((repository.url, git_sha))
for font in repository.fonts:
with api.step.nest(font.name):
pkg_dir = cipd_pkg_dir.join(font.name)
api.file.ensure_directory('make %s dir' % font.name, pkg_dir)
for filename in font.files:
path = list(font.path) + [filename]
api.file.copy(filename, src_dir.join(*path), pkg_dir)
api.file.copy(font.license[-1], src_dir.join(*font.license), pkg_dir)
git_repositories.sort()
git_repository = ','.join(r for r, _ in git_repositories)
git_revision = ','.join(r for _, r in git_repositories)
api.upload.cipd_package(
'fuchsia/third_party/fonts',
cipd_pkg_dir, [api.upload.DirectoryPath(cipd_pkg_dir)],
{'git_revision': git_revision},
repository=git_repository)
